Walden Farms Calorie Free Caramel Dip

Walden Farms Calorie Free Caramel DipHave you tried any of the calorie-free products from Walden Farms? They focus on sales and distribution of specialty sauces featuring no carbohydrates, no sugar, no fat, no cholesterol and no calories. I have tried several of their products and I must say I've yet to find something that I like. I was hoping this Walden Farms Calorie Free Caramel Dip would be the answer to my prayers, but unfortunately I was once more left disappointed.

After seeing how thick the caramel looked, I was willing to give it a shot. I must admit I was kind of excited but that feeling didn't last too long. I opened it and scoop a spoonful of caramel dip, the texture looked nice, creamy and thick but unfortunately that was all that was good in this product. The taste was bland, kind of sweet, but very far from resembling a delicious caramel flavor. After eating it, I experienced an awful, kind of weird and bitter after taste. Believe me when I tell you that you really don't want to find out for yourself, just stay away from it!

This product is calorie-free, carb free, fat free, sugar free and I must add flavor free. A 12 ounce bottle is sold on Amazon.com
for $5.00, but I wouldn't recommend it. I'll keep searching for a lower-calorie option that doesn't have to sacrifice that much flavor to be these nutritionally enticing. Could someone please recommend any Walden Farms products that they have enjoyed?!
